Add freehire-search: country-agnostic freehire.dev aggregator skill (#85)
* feat(freehire-search): add country-agnostic freehire.dev aggregator skill
Adds a portal-search skill over the freehire.dev public JSON API — an
open-source IT job aggregator normalizing ~50 ATS platforms across many
markets into one schema. Like linkedin-search it is country-agnostic and
zero-dependency (plain bun + fetch), but it queries a JSON API rather than
scraping HTML, so results carry structured facets (skills/seniority/region).
Honors the portal-skill contract: search + detail commands, --format
json|table|plain, stderr JSON errors with exit 1, backoff on 429/5xx. Reads
are public (no API key) — the same zero-signup bar as linkedin-search. The
hosted-service dependency (best-effort, no SLA) is labeled prominently in
SKILL.md, and FREEHIRE_API_URL swaps the base URL for a self-hosted backend.
Scoped tech-first: triggers cover software/data/engineering roles, where the
faceted filtering is strong; non-tech coverage exists but is still maturing.
Network-free tests (mocked fetch + pure reshape/parse functions); CI matrix
updated to typecheck the new CLI.
